I set up the world, injecting the norngarden and other usefuls, then hatch a bunch of pairs of norns, always 2 male, 2 female. i take care of them normally for 2 or 3 generation, then i put a challenge such as stinking stumps in the hub for 2 generations, the another challenge, such as a bubonicfor 2 gen, then i hatch a pair of banshees, plant botanoids in the workshop, leave all doors unlocked, and leave. I come back about 2-6 hours later, weed out try to weed out all fastagers, repeat until im bored of that world. this is my "evil run", and the norns that result are usually quite tough.

I hadn't done a wolfling in several months, so this prompted me to start one. Typically, I add Terra, Terra Reborn, and Norngarden1 since I work in DS only and like a bigger world for the norns to roam. This time I also used the CoC Rooms, and the Canopy Alpha. I inject the autonamer and the DS Plantpack 1. This time, I also added the Lensis, Inkras, and Okiron butterflies, just for the heck of it, and three other plants from what I believe was another plantpack by Prime. Then, I pretty much let it run, but this particular run I've decided to accept warp norns. If anyone wants to send to me, I believe my DS name is also rainbowcat1.
